Right now I'll give you a little overview of what has happened in the first 206 pages. Hannah Baker ,a local highschool girl, has committed suicide. Clay Jensen a local high school guy had had a crush on Hannah Baker for as long as he can remember. When a mysterious box of tapes shows up at his doorstep addressed to him with no return address, he gets curious. He opens the box to find 13 tapes. He pops the first one in to hear a familiar voice. You guessed it, Hannah Baker, and shes made the tapes to tell her 13 reasons why she committed suicide. She says that starting with the first reason person, the box has been sent out in order of all the thirteen people whom have helped contribute to her death. Clay quickly realizes that this means that he is one of the reasons she died. This consumes Clay in despair and he go's on a mission to find out what he did. She had included a map along with the thirteen tapes of places to visit while listening to her voice to them a better understanding. You would think, well maybe it's all a scam maybe it's not real, maybe Clay shouldn't listen to them but, Hannah's first tape warned that if they were to not to listen to all 13 tapes and send it to the next person on the list after them or she would have people publish the tapes to the public.
